Buy to let properties can offer a great return on your investment. In the UK alone two million people, or 5 %, have a second home which they rent out. This has increased by 300,000 in the last five years. The number of buy to let mortgages has increased by 98% since 1994.
On average the typical landlord is a male aged 36 to 55 with another job along with their property investment. Most landlords see their property portfolio as a retirement safety net.

10 Year low in mortgage lending

Friday, March 5th, 2010

So just when we thought the doom and gloom was over, the news is out that January 2010’s gross mortgage lending was 21% down on the same time last year.

Not only that, but just in case we weren’t depressed enough, the Councilof Mortgage Lenders tell us that the figure was a 10 year low, with ‘just’ £9.1bn during the month.

We’d usually expect a fall at the start of the year, but with months of rising interest ending, we weren’t quite expecting a 10 year low!

Of course, it could have something to do with the end of the temporary stamp duty holiday on homes of less than £175k, as house purchases grew in December 2009. (more…)
